In 1866, Elizabeth Ann Slater entered the world in COLCHESTER, MCDONOUGH, ILL., born to Thomas Slater And Mary Jane Wilson. In 1910, Elizabeth Ann Slater resided in Washington, Crawford, Kansas, USA. Elizabeth Ann Slater married George Halliday, and had children including Child Halliday, Lillian Halliday, Mabel Halliday, Mary J Halliday, Thelma Parker. Elizabeth Ann Slater passed away in 1957 in Mulberry, Crawford County, Kansas, United States of America.
